A Pair of ‘Dylan Dog: Dead Of Night’ TV Spots

In theaters April 29 from Freestyle Releasing is Dylan Dog: Dead Of Night, Kevin Munroe’s live-action adaptation of the popular Italian comic book that stars Brandon Routh, Sam Huntington, Anita Briem, Taye Diggs, Kyle Russell Clements, Peter Stormare, and WWE wrestler Kurt Angle.

Inside you’ll find the first two official TV Spots, along with the previously released poster and trailer. Are you planning on checking it out?

‘Dylan Dog’ is a new horror/comedy film based on one of the world’s most popular comics (60 million copies worldwide). Brandon Routh stars as the title character, world famous private investigator specializing in affairs of the undead. His PI business card reads “No Pulse? No Problem.” Armed with an edgy wit and carrying an arsenal of silver and wood-tipped bullets, Dylan must track down a dangerous artifact before a war ensues between his werewolf, vampire and zombie clients living undercover in the monster infested backstreets of New Orleans.
